Abstract
The problem of signature inversion is studied by using a model of particles coupled to a rotor. We have assumed an axially symmetric equilibrium deformation and taken into account the γ vibration around it. The calculated signature dependence is found inverted in agreement with the experimental data if we adopt a set of moments of inertia which favor the rotation around the shortest axis, but not if we employ the set of the irrotational-flow model.
